Saturday, 4 June 2016

Ed Force One - ZRH

June 2nd arrival in Zurich and I found out two of my greatest fans were there. François Hollande and Angela Merkel. Who would have known?!? Both of them headbangers.

Ed Force One - SFX

Pics from Berlin.

Thursday, 26 May 2016

Ed Force One - DUS

May 26th - Ich bin in Düsseldorf! I arrived just a little while ago after spending a few days resting at home.